Marchex, Inc. (NASDAQ:MCHX), a mobile advertising technology
company, today released two new technologies, Call DNA and Dynamic
Tracking, designed to significantly lower customer acquisition
costs for advertisers by providing insights into which calls
convert into sales. These patent-pending technologies provide a new
and deeper level of customer conversion data generated by ad
campaigns.
Call DNA and Dynamic Tracking also create greater consumer
privacy protection and increase time efficiency for advertisers who
no longer have to listen to calls to understand customer
conversations.

Call DNA and Dynamic Tracking are part of the Marchex Call
Analytics platform and address long-standing advertiser challenges.
For years, advertisers have struggled to understand the quality of
inbound phone calls coming from their digital ad campaigns. Because
of rapid smartphone adoption, call volumes are increasing, which
has intensified the need for a solution. In fact, Google released a
study last month showing that 70% of consumers searching on mobile
call businesses directly from their phones.
Now, with the launch of Call DNA and Dynamic Tracking,
businesses can cost-effectively determine which keywords or
impressions in these calls lead to high-quality customer
conversations and sales at scale.
Call DNA provides:
- A simple, easy-to-understand visual of
what happens on phone calls using automated call scoring
technology.
- A break-down of what leads to improved
sales and overall business performance.
Dynamic Tracking provides:
- Details on what, exactly, triggered a
phone call from a mobile consumer to an advertiser. This includes
specific keywords, ad impressions and Web-based sessions.
- Easy campaign optimization to drive
more calls from new customers.
Marchex’s technologies also shed new light on flawed metrics
which have been traditionally used to measure customer outcomes.
For instance, the length of time a customer spends on the phone
with a business often has been a standard indicator of a “good”
call. However, data from Call DNA trials reveals that callers often
stay on hold for long periods of time without connecting to an
agent.
